Your Sustainability Program Means Business

It’s true.  Studies show American consumers want to and DO buy from companies that apply sustainable and environmentally sound practices.  In fact, 86% of them trust a company that talks about sustainability and 82% of them are more likely to purchase from those companies. 

 

So, if you are wondering if you should look at your eco-packaging initiatives a little more, the answer is "YES.”  There are many resources on why sustainability matters.  Numerous organizations and industrial associations have workshops, workbooks and check-lists about putting a sustainability program into practice.  State governments also have resources, as does the Federal government.
